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
662934678 908 3424992080
1255580310 830847 702847
1255580310 830847 702847
75475678 1943425 114111502
All about undefined
Interested in learning more?
1255580310 830847 702847
75475678 1943425 114111502
See more
735809 923595563
5829221 32785883921 507
See more
364805332 84847
751 520391 025 80126
See more